Subject: Re: [Intel-gfx] [PATCH v2 22/22] drm/i915/bios: Dump PNPID and panel name
Date: Thu, 07 Apr 2022 21:07:19 +0300 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<87r1683gyw.fsf@intel.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220405173410.11436-23-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com>
On Tue, 05 Apr 2022, Ville Syrjala <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com> wrote:
> From: Ville Syrjälä <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com>
>
> Dump the panel PNPID and name from the VBT.
>
> Signed-off-by: Ville Syrjälä <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com>
> ---
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_bios.c | 24 +++++++++++++++++++++++
> 1 file changed, 24 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_bios.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_bios.c
> index d561551d6324..953526a7dc5d 100644
> --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_bios.c
> +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_bios.c
> @@ -25,6 +25,7 @@
> *
> */
>
> +#include <drm/drm_edid.h>
> #include <drm/dp/drm_dp_helper.h>
>
> #include "display/intel_display.h"
> @@ -597,6 +598,19 @@ get_lfp_data_tail(const struct bdb_lvds_lfp_data *data,
> return NULL;
> }
>
> +static void dump_pnp_id(struct drm_i915_private *i915,
> + const struct lvds_pnp_id *pnp_id,
> + const char *name)
> +{
> + u16 mfg_name = be16_to_cpu((__force __be16)pnp_id->mfg_name);
Might just add the __be16 in the struct member?
Reviewed-by: Jani Nikula <jani.nikula@intel.com>
